Frequently Asked Questions

How do Pratt Institute-Main and University of North Carolina Wilmington compare?
Pratt Institute-Main (Brooklyn, NY) has an acceptance rate of 73.3%, in-state tuition of $61,845, and median 10-year earnings of $54,295. University of North Carolina Wilmington (Wilmington, NC) has an acceptance rate of 64.2%, in-state tuition of $7,277, and median 10-year earnings of $54,967.
Which school has higher graduate earnings, Pratt Institute-Main or University of North Carolina Wilmington?
University of North Carolina Wilmington graduates earn more at 10 years out, with a median of $54,967 vs $54,295. Source: U.S. Department of Education College Scorecard.
Which school is more affordable, Pratt Institute-Main or University of North Carolina Wilmington?
Based on average net price (after grants and scholarships), University of North Carolina Wilmington is the more affordable option at $20,109 per year versus $52,659.
Which school has a better 4-year graduation rate?
Pratt Institute-Main has the higher 4-year graduation rate: 73.1% vs 70.7%.
